Usually denoted as "maf" or "MAF." Moist, mineral-matter-free basis: For some low-rank coals, this basis is used to calculate calorific value. It uses a theoretical base as if there were no mineral matter, but includes the moisture content of the coal sample. How can we increase GCV of coal?

For estimation of the GCV, we used an oxygen bomb calorimeter, the Parr 6100 Series. A bomb calorimeter measures the heat of combustion of a particular material under set conditions. A bomb was prepared with Ni-Cr fuse wire for GCV calculation. One-gram coal sample was taken for the analysis (ASTM D5865) [6]. 3. RESULT AND …

Inh erent or equilibrium moisture is used for calcula ting moist mineral-matter-free calorific values for the rank classification o f high-volatile bituminous coals. It is also used f or estimating
